Modeling and Validation of PV Solar-Thermoelectric Generators Using Magnetized Nanofluids

Abstract: Objective:To develop a simulation model to predict the behavior of a hybrid system composed of a PV-Thermal panel and thermoelectric generator (TEG) using magnetized nanofluids. Methods:The model has been established after the energy and mass conservation equations for magnetized nanofluids coupled with the heat transfer equations nanofluids for Al 2 O 3 , CuO, Fe 3 O 4 , and SiO 2 , and the key parameters of the TEG.
